Academic Overview
Saint Vincent Seminary is a private (not-for-profit), four-years institute located in Latrobe, Pennsylvania. It is a Theological seminaries, Bible college, and other faith-related institution by Carnegie Classification and its highest degree is Master's degree.
Saint Vincent Seminary is affiliated with Roman Catholic.
The 2023 graduate school tuition & fees is $32,978.
The school offers only graduate programs and a total of 66 students are enrolled.
The salary after graduation from Saint Vincent Seminary varies by major programs where the average earning after 10 years is $52,100. You can check the average salary by the major programs on the area of study page.

Offered Degrees
Saint Vincent Seminary offers 5 major programs through online and on-site education where 1 programs are available through distance learning. The following table lists the number of programs by offered degree with online class availabilities.
Award Level | Total Number of Programs | Available Online Class |
---|---|---|
Master's | 4 | 0 |
Post-Bachelor's Certificate | 1 | 1 |
